Frontal
Pertaining to the frontal lobe of the brain, which is involved in executive functions such as decision making, problem solving, and controlling behavior and emotions.
Parietal
Pertaining to the parietal lobe of the brain, involved in processing sensory information regarding the location of parts of the body as well as processing language and mathematics.
Occipital Lobes
The region of the brain located at the back of the head, responsible for processing visual information from the eyes.
Anterior Commissure
A bundle of nerve fibers connecting the two hemispheres of the brain, playing a role in pain sensation and other functions.
